Release checklist — map-tile prefetcher (Cartovane v3): Confirm the prefetch queue drains within 90 seconds on the Brellis staging ring before promoting. Verify the new LRU eviction honors the 2 GB cap on low-memory kiosk units, and that offline regions marked by Fenwood field teams are pinned. If the queue stalls, page the tiles rotation, not core infra. Record verification results against the build token printed below.

session token of kageg-tahop = htk14_af3c1ccccb7dcf

## Deployment: Zero-Downtime Schema Migrations

For the weekly sync: the Larkspur service applies schema changes using the expand-contract pattern. Every migration must be backward compatible with the previous release, since old and new pods overlap during rollout. We first add nullable columns, deploy code that writes to both shapes, backfill via the Tidemill worker, then drop the old columns one full release later. Never combine expand and contract steps in a single deploy. The migration runner reads the values shown below:

deployment values, yadup-kadug:
[sorys]
port = 5672
team = noveth
host = sorys.orvexcorp.example
region = south-4
access_code = ac_deddc1
timeout_ms = 1500

Step 4: Migrating the Quillmark rendering pipeline. Before switching renderers, snapshot the current document cache so diffs against the new output are possible. Disable the legacy sanitizer flag only after confirming the new pipeline escapes embedded HTML identically. Run the comparison harness against at least one full corpus export. The harness stores rendered fingerprints in the migration database, which it reaches via the connection string below.

replica DSN, yahaf-yagaf: mongodb://tamath_svc:a2netSk3RZMuTj@db-d084.novacsoft.internal:5432/ralmir